Role: Target Housing is seeking an experienced Service Manager to lead one of our supported housing services.

This is an exciting opportunity for an established manager who enjoys leading people, driving service quality and developing teams.

The successful candidate will provide operational leadership, ensuring high-quality, person-centred services are delivered safely, effectively and in line with contractual and regulatory requirements.

Working closely with the Head of Operations, you will support service development, embed best practice and ensure the service continues to achieve positive outcomes for the people we support.

Key Responsibilities

  • Provide day-to-day operational leadership of the service.
  • Lead, motivate and develop a team of Team Leaders and Support Workers.
  • Ensure services are delivered in line with contractual requirements, organisational policies and regulatory standards.
  • Monitor performance, quality and service outcomes, taking appropriate action where required.
  • Oversee safeguarding, risk management and health and safety compliance.
  • Manage staffing, supervision, absence, performance and employee development.
  • Build effective relationships with commissioners, local authorities and partner agencies.
  • Support service improvement initiatives and contribute to organisational development.
  • Manage budgets and resources responsibly.
  • Produce accurate reports, maintain high standards of record keeping and maintain and deliver KPI’s.

Essential Criteria. Applicants must be able to demonstrate

  • Experience of managing teams within supported housing, homelessness, housing support or similar services.
  • Experience of leading staff through change and maintaining high levels of performance.
  • Strong knowledge of safeguarding, risk management and regulatory compliance.
  • Experience of performance management, supervision and staff development.
  • Excellent organisational and communication skills.
  • Ability to build productive relationships with internal and external stakeholders.
  • Full UK driving licence and access to a vehicle.

Desirable

  • Experience of managing geographically dispersed teams.
  • Knowledge of commissioned support services.
  • Experience of contract performance and KPI management.
  • Understanding of trauma-informed approaches.
  • Previous experience within asylum or migrant support services.
